Advertisement

S_AXI_to_Stream模块.v

  •  5星
  •     浏览量: 0
  •     大小:None
  •      文件类型:None


简介:
S_AXI_to_Stream模块.v 是一个Verilog文件,实现了一种AXI到AXI流接口的转换模块,用于连接支持AXI协议的主设备和遵循AXI流协议的从设备。 Xilinx AXI-memory接口转AXI-stream接口的转换模块的具体详情可以查看源码。

全部评论 (0)

还没有任何评论哟~
客服
客服
  • S_AXI_to_Stream.v
    优质
    S_AXI_to_Stream模块.v 是一个Verilog文件,实现了一种AXI到AXI流接口的转换模块,用于连接支持AXI协议的主设备和遵循AXI流协议的从设备。 Xilinx AXI-memory接口转AXI-stream接口的转换模块的具体详情可以查看源码。
  • AD7606 VVerilog代码
    优质
    这段Verilog代码是为AD7606 V模块设计的,旨在实现其模拟到数字转换功能,并优化了信号处理效率和精度。适用于需要高分辨率数据采集系统的应用。 FPGA AD7606 300K 8路采集,使用AXI传输数据。
  • ad7606驱动程序.v
    优质
    本模块为AD7606多通道同步采样模数转换器提供定制化驱动程序,旨在简化其在各类数据采集系统中的集成与操作过程。 最近几天比较闲,我把手头的AD7606 AD模块用Verilog在FPGA上调试成功了。实现了AD7606 8通道同步采集,并以16位行输出的形式呈现结果。代码简洁明了,已经亲测可行,只是数据未进行转换处理,需要自行完成转化工作。
  • RISC-V调试的实现:riscv-debug
    优质
    riscv-debug是针对RISC-V架构设计的一款高效能调试工具模块。它提供了全面的调试功能,包括断点设置、寄存器读写和内存访问等,极大地方便了软件开发与系统测试过程。 关于这个项目: 实现RISC-V调试规范(版本1.3) 目标平台:DE10-Lite 本项目使用的调试传输是英特尔FPGA虚拟JTAG。 riscv-openocd目录包含VJTAG支持。
  • 包含FIFO的Verilog UART(单个.v文件)
    优质
    本设计提供了一个简洁高效的UART模块Verilog代码,采用FIFO实现数据缓冲,支持异步通信,适用于串行通信接口开发。 参考黑金的串口收发方法,在一个.v文件中实现串口收发和FIFO的功能。操作接口主要使用FIFO:当rx_fifo_empty不等于1时,表示接收到数据,可以从FIFO读取;发送串口只需将数据存入FIFO即可。接收过程中需要判断起始位为低电平以及停止位为高电平,以防止上电前由于外部存在持续的数据传输而导致的误码问题。
  • 验证双V
    优质
    《验证双V模型》一文探讨并实证了“双V”理论模型在特定情境下的有效性,通过严谨的数据分析和案例研究,为该模型的应用提供了坚实的证据支持。 测试管理方式是指在软件开发过程中对测试活动进行计划、组织、协调及控制的方法和流程。有效的测试管理能够确保项目的质量和进度目标得以实现,并且有助于团队成员之间的沟通与协作,提高整体工作效率。 常见的测试管理模式包括瀑布模型下的线性阶段管理和敏捷方法中的迭代式调整策略等。不同的项目需求和技术环境可能需要采用不同类型的测试管理方式来达到最佳效果。选择合适的测试管理体系对于保证软件产品质量具有重要意义。
  • RISC-V 拟器:RISC 的简易仿真器-V
    优质
    RISC-V模拟器:RISC的简易仿真器-V是一款专为学习和研究RISC-V架构设计的软件工具。它提供了一个用户友好的界面,方便开发者在不依赖硬件的情况下进行代码调试与测试,是初学者了解RISC-V指令集的理想选择。 项目介绍:RISC-V 仿真器 1. 项目简介: 本项目旨在创建一个简单的单周期 RISC-V 模拟器,能够执行 add、addi、beq、jal、jalr、ld 和 sd 等指令。我实现了部分源代码,并基于课程提供的主要骨架代码进行开发。根据 RISC-V 的流水线模型,我的代码由五个模块组成:指令提取(Instruction Fetch)、解码(Decode)、执行(Execute)、内存访问(Memory)和回写(Write Back)。 2. 代码说明: 在解释之前,请先了解我对部分原始框架的修改内容。初始化阶段中,为了方便指令解析,我创建了一个数组来指示从最低有效位到最高有效位的32个比特位置。计算机的基本地址单位为8字节,即一个字大小是4字节。RISC-V 使用 4 字节指令长度,因此程序计数器(PC)始终以 4 的倍数递增。然而,在这个模拟中我们一次读取一条十六进制格式的指令。 解码阶段:在此部分,模块需要解析出具体的指令类型,并从寄存器文件里取出所需的数据。在这一节内,我们需要明确执行、加法以及回写等操作的具体步骤和逻辑关系。
  • 基于型开发的MATLAB Simulink验证与确认(V&V)
    优质
    本简介探讨了利用MATLAB Simulink进行复杂系统建模时,如何实施有效的验证与确认(V&V)策略,确保设计质量和可靠性。 基于模型的开发(Model-Based Design, MBD)在现代工程领域尤其是航空和汽车行业扮演着重要角色。MATLAB Simulink作为MBD的一种强大工具,在系统设计、仿真及代码生成方面被广泛应用。本段落着重探讨如何利用Simulink进行有效的验证与确认,以确保设计的质量和合规性。 验证(Validation)是检查模型是否正确实现了预定功能的过程,即核实其是否符合需求规范。这包括对模型的功能仿真、预期结果与实际结果的比较以及极端条件下的测试等环节。通过这些步骤可以保证设计目标的一致性和系统的可靠性。 在验证过程中可能会执行以下操作: 1. 功能性验证:利用仿真来评估输入和输出行为,确保其符合设计规范。 2. 性能验证:评价模型在特定性能指标下(如计算速度、资源使用情况等)的表现。 3. 边界条件测试:检查系统在极限条件下是否能够正常运行。 与此同时,确认(Verification)则关注于内部结构的准确性。这包括: 1. 结构审查:确保组件配置和连接关系合理且无误。 2. 代码审查:如果模型转换为可执行代码,则需对其源码的质量进行评估。 3. 模型一致性检查:对比设计文档与实际模型,保证两者的一致性。 在航空和汽车行业中,V&V过程必须遵循严格的适航标准及安全规定,如DO-178C(针对航空电子软件)和ISO 26262(关于汽车功能的安全要求)。这些规范强调了详细记录的重要性,以确保所有活动的可追溯性和审计能力。 MATLAB Simulink提供了一系列工具来支持V&V工作,例如Simulink Checker用于结构与编码标准检查;Simulink Test Manager负责测试用例的设计和管理;Simulink Coverage帮助度量模型覆盖率,并通过Simulink Report Generator生成详尽报告。 文件夹内的slvv可能代表了Simulink V&V相关文档的简写,包括但不限于模型、测试案例及验证报告等资源。这有助于学习者或工程师更好地理解并实践于Simulink环境中的V&V流程。 基于模型的设计通过MATLAB Simulink进行验证与确认是保证复杂系统设计质量和符合行业标准的关键步骤。它涵盖了全面的功能测试、严格的结构审查以及满足特定安全要求,从而降低潜在风险,提升产品的可靠性和安全性。深入学习和应用这一领域的知识可以提高工程师的工作效率,并确保最终产品达到高质量标准。
  • GAMP-V型图解说明
    优质
    《GAMP-V模型图解说明》旨在通过直观图表解析GAMP-V(验证级别)模型,帮助读者理解在不同场景下实施质量管理和合规验证的最佳实践策略。 GAMP-V模型图示说明了软件开发各个阶段的基本情况。
  • CODE V光学拟软件
    优质
    CODE V是一款专业的光学设计和分析软件,用于复杂光学系统的建模、优化及公差分析,在科研与工业界广泛应用。 光学建模软件是一种强大而灵活的工具,用于解决各种光学问题。